Toyota may launch Toyota Corolla Altis Aero limited edition diesel trim in India
Toyota Kirloskar Motor (TKM) may launch Toyota Corolla Altis Aero limited edition diesel trim in the Indian car market but it will depend on demand. For now, Corolla Altis Aero has been introduced in petrol variant only. TKM has launched limited units of Corolla Altis in India. The car has been made available in the market with a price tag of Rs 11.47 lakh, which is its ex showroom price in Delhi.

The car would attract the buyers as it offers choice in color — silver mica metallic and black mica. The company has introduced 500 exclusive units for sale till September 2012 across its nationwide dealership in India. The car enthusiasts love Toyota Corolla Altis because of its sporty image, aerodynamic design and high end features. Also, the other features are it comes with 7 spoke alloy wheels, leather seating, smoked tail lamps and it will be based on the 1.8 litre Euro IV Grade variant. The style quotient of the car including its exclusive aero emblem and dual tone seats with aero logo would appeal the customers.

TKM has introduced Corolla Altis Aero on the occasion of completing 10 years of Corolla Altis in the Indian market. Industry source said that since Corolla Altis has become a popular brand in the market because of its presence in the Indian market completes 10 years, the TKM has decided to launch Corolla Altis Aero. It will be a petrol engine vehicle but in the coming days there are possibilities that TKM could launch its Toyota Corolla Altis Aero limited edition diesel trim. The media report suggests that the company is estimating the demand of the diesel car before it launch in the Indian market.
